Which one should you vape? Keep reading to find out more about these two concentrated oils! CO2 CartridgesĬO2 cartridges are named after the CO2 extraction process that produces the oil they contain. While CO2 cartridges are highly effective and cost-efficient, live resin cartridges contain a higher amount of natural terpenes and tend to be more flavorful.
